The team played in its first ISC II Tournament of Champions last year, and are headed to the ISC World Tournament this year as the # 25 ranked team. In last year’s ISC II Tournament of Champions, pitcher Jonas Mach from the Czech Republic broke the tournament strikeout record, only to be eclipsed later in the tournament by Micksburg’s Cory Costello, after the Merchants were eliminated from the tournament. Costello will be back at the ISC II tournament this year with the # 1 ranked Niagara Snappers.

The Thomson Area Merchants had their best tournament of the year at the AFSA Classic in Illinois recently, where they knocked off # 8 ranked Circle Tap.

Thomson at AFSA Classic

Thomson, Illinois

The Thomson Merchants had their best weekend to date in the 2007
season at the recently completed AFSA Classic in Aurora. A lot
of hard work and perseverance over recent weeks appears to be
finally showing through in the teams improved defense and hitting
performances. Against 4 fellow Kitchener bound ISC teams the
Merchants completed a 2-2 record, included a victory over Circle
Tap, a major milestone for our team.

The Merchants finally managed to put together a 7 innings display
of team softball to knock off a ” Top 10 ” ranked team for the
first time this season. Steve Manson got the ball rolling for
THomson with a single in the 1st and was moved over to 3 on a
errored hit by Casey Eden. Manson and Eden them both scampered
home on a double to Bruce Bielema. Not content with only 2 RBI
Bielema added a timely Home Run in the 4th to extend the Merchants
lead to 3-1. Then our all too famous fielding errors threatened
to break the Thomson charge in the 4th when 3 straight fielding
errors on routine plays helped contribute to 2 runs driven in
off the bat of Circle Taps Tom Crouch. However the Merchants
showed some character by immediately striking back in the 5th
with a hugh two run home run from Steve Manson off the first
pitch thrown by Circle Tap reliever Colin McKenzie. Roberto Bahler
then shut down Circle Tap for the remaining 3 innings to secure
the win for Thomson. Thomson center fielder Q Cody also managed
to make an amazing home run saving grab on a well hit ball in
the 3rd innings, which helped to shut down any Circle Tap charge.

After finishing in a 3 way tie for first in our pool with a 2-1
record we ended up with the 3rd seed due to run differential.
This meant we ended up playing close neighbors Quad City Sox
in the evenings quarter final battle.

After taking the lead in the 2nd on another Bruce Bielema HR
Thomson was unable to maintain our composure from earlier in
the day as we eventually ran out losers to the Sox 4-3. Despite
out hitting the Sox the elusive game tying run proved out of
our reach in the 7th after loading up the bases, but a lot of
heart was shown to stay in the game to the very last pitch.
